So back to the Workshop , and time to make the office into a room for Cronus to stay in.

I already had a fire in my room and heres a how we turned the office into a room, very cosy for a winter. He made a bed there too in the second picture.


We had a huge yard at the workshop and made a green house ready for spring to start growing food and some weed for our personal use. There was a shed out the back full of junk and lots of plastic. With the trees I had cut to stop leaves falling on the roof, we had enough material to make a huge greenhouse lashed together with string. We made Hugel culture taking the rotten wood that seemed to be in mass there and started making rows hugel style.

Heres the epic South-facing greenhouse.
